Integrated Plant Nutrition Management Bill, 2022

- Central government has proposed a law to empower it to fix maximum selling price of fertilizers and control its quality and distribution.
- Department of Fertilizers has asked comments on the draft Integrated Plant Nutrition Management Bill, 2022, from all the stakeholders.
- It is convenient in public interest that central government should take under its control on distribution, price and quality of standards of fertilizers.
- The bill seeks to establish an ‘Integrated Plant Nutrition Management Authority of India’.
- It is aimed at promoting development and sustainable use of balanced fertilizers, including bio-fertilizers, nano-fertilizers, bio-stimulates, and organic fertilizers.
- It seeks to simplify the process for manufacturing production, distribution and price management of fertilizers across India. This will help in improving the ease of doing business.
- Central Government would be able to fix maximum prices or rates at which any fertilizer may be sold by a dealer, importer, manufacturer, or fertilizer marketing entity.
- It also aims to empower Centre to fix different rates or prices for fertilizers having different periods of storage or for different classes of consumers or for different areas.
- No person would be able to manufacture, import for sale, sell, or market without obtaining appropriate registration.
